Subject: [PATCH] perl/Git.pm: add parse_rev method
Date: Fri, 30 May 2008 22:27:50 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1212179270-26170-1-git-send-email-LeWiemann@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20080530095047.GD18781@machine.or.cz>
The parse_rev method takes a revision name and returns a SHA1 hash,
like the git-rev-parse command.

+=item parse_rev ( REVISION_NAME )
+
+Look up the specified revision name and return the SHA1 hash, or
+return undef if the lookup failed. See git rev-parse --help, section
+"Specifying Revisions".
+
+=cut
+
+sub parse_rev {
+ # We could allow for a list of revisions here.
+ my ($self, $rev_name) = @_;
+
+ my $hash;
+ try {
+ # The --quiet --verify options cause git-rev-parse to fail
+ # with exit status 1 (instead of 128) if the given revision
+ # name is not found, which enables us to distinguish not-found
+ # from serious errors. The --default option works around
+ # git-rev-parse's lack of support for getopt style "--"
+ # separators (it would fail for tags named "--foo" without
+ # it).
+ $hash = $self->command_oneline("rev-parse", "--verify", "--quiet",
+ "--default", $rev_name);
+ } catch Git::Error::Command with {
+ my $E = shift;
+ if ($E->value() == 1) {
+ # Revision name not found.
+ $hash = undef;
+ } else {
+ throw $E;
+ }
+ };
+ # Guard against unexpected output.
+ throw Error::Simple(
+ "parse_rev: unexpected output for \"$rev_name\": $hash")
+ if defined $hash and $hash !~ /^([0-9a-fA-F]{40})$/;
+ return $hash;
+}
